作者remember11 (恩维)
看板Network
标题[问答] 如何从wireshark看spanning tree的状态
时间Mon Feb 4 19:39:14 2013
请问各位大大
小弟正在学习spanning tree
目前是用2台Router和1台switch
三台互接
用wireshark看封包
但是找不到每个port的状态
listening
blocking
learning
forwarding
disable
请问要如何从wireshark查询这些状态??
或是有其他方法可以查询??
谢谢
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 59.120.184.171
1F:推 deadwood:用console线接到交换机去show spann XXX比较快吧.... 0.0 02/04 22:46
2F:→ deadwood:再说,spanning tree是switch互接才会有的,你一台会有? 02/04 22:48
3F:推 deadwood:除非你的ROUTER都用SWITCH模组在接的.... 02/04 22:55
我这台switch的console端下的command
原本就没有显示每个port的在STP下状态
只有显示每个port的STP有没有enable
所以才想说有没有其它办法查询
我的Router有switch chip
我用wireshark去看三台互接的封包
确实有跑STP
且我也可以改MAC address和priority去决定哪台switch要当Root
但是就是没办法看他们跑STP下的状态@@
4F:→ coenobita:STP是L2的Protocol,主要是防止switch loop 02/05 00:26
5F:→ coenobita:拜一下咕狗大神,你会学到很多 02/05 00:27
可以麻烦大大给关键字吗
我不知道该怎用wireshark去看STP下每个port的状态
※ 编辑: remember11 来自: 59.120.184.171 (02/05 09:45)
※ 编辑: remember11 来自: 59.120.184.171 (02/05 09:46)
6F:推 deadwood:会教你进机器下指令看是因为BPDU是看不出port状态的 02/05 13:35
7F:→ deadwood:BPDU里面根本没有PORT STATUS这个讯息栏位,仔细看过 02/05 13:36
8F:→ deadwood:spanning tree的运作方式了吗? 02/05 13:36
9F:→ deadwood:至於你的机器看不到port状态,你要查的是指令手册才对 02/05 13:38
10F:推 deadwood:CISCO的设备只要打 show spanning-tree就能看到port状态 02/05 13:42
11F:→ deadwood:其他厂牌的话小弟不才还没研究,建议找原厂手册比较快 02/05 13:43
12F:→ yuchihsu:port status 是设备是上才有.不会透过网路交换吧.. 02/06 21:46